How can individuals create a personalized stress management plan that incorporates their identified triggers, stress responses, and coping strategies to effectively navigate high-pressure situations in their daily lives?
Individuals can create a personalized stress management plan by first identifying their triggers through self-reflection and awareness of their reactions to stressful situations. They can then develop coping strategies that align with their triggers, such as deep breathing exercises, mindfulness techniques, or physical activity. It is important to practice these coping strategies regularly to build resilience and effectively navigate high-pressure situations. Additionally, seeking support from a therapist or counselor can provide guidance in developing a personalized stress management plan tailored to individual needs and circumstances.
